$80 at 1% Interest for 40 Years
How much money will your investment be worth if you let the interest grow?
After investing for 40 years at 1% interest, your initial investment of $80 will have grown to $119.11.
You will have earned $39.11 in interest.
How much will savings of $80 be worth in 40 years if invested at a 1.00% interest rate?
This calculator determines the future value of $80 invested for 40 years at a constant yield of 1.00% compounded annually.
